Firefox tweaking-guide

Tråden skapades och har fått 48 svar. Det senaste inlägget skrevs .

Hade tänkt skriva en liten guide hur du tweakar Firefox,
Firefox tycker jag klarar av alla sidor bättre än Safari, därför använder jag Firefox.
Som standard är Firefox aningen långsammare än safari, men det går att ändra på.
Likaså så går det att få den att öppna alla länkar osv i nya tabbar, istället för i nya fönster.

Jag kommer sammanställa en liten guide hur du ska gå till väga, tyvärr så kommer det krävas att du går in i nåt som heter About:config, vilket i runda slängar inställningsfilen för FF(firefox)

Vi börjar med att göra så att alla länkar öppnas i nya tabbar:

Skriv About:config i adressfältet i FF

Skriv sen i Filter, singlewindow.openexternal , ändra sen value till true
gör likadant med singlewindow.openintabs , sätt den till true

Nu ska alla dina länkar öppnas i nya tabbar istället för nya fönster.

För att snabba upp FF så kan du ifall du sitter på bredband/adsl ändra i About:config så att sidorna laddas snabbare. Det du kan göra är att aktivera pipelining och ändra tiden FF ska vänta med att "rita" upp den information FF får från webbservern.

I vanliga fall så gör webbläsaren bara en request till servern, men när du aktiverar pipelining så gör den flera samtidigt. Vilket snabbar upp sidladdningarna rejält.

Så här gör du för att snabba upp sidladdningarna:

Skriv About:config i adressfältet i FF
Bläddra ner till network.http.max-connections sätt value till 48
sätt sen network.http.max-connections-per-server value till 24
och network.http.max-persistent-connections-per-proxy till value 6
och network.http.max-persistent-connections-per-server till value 4
och network.http.pipelining till true
och slutligen network.http.pipelining.maxrequests till value 10

Och till sist så kan du säga till FF hur snabbt den ska vänta med att "rita" upp informationen den får från servrarna:

I about:config
Höger klicka någonstans på ett tomt ställe, välj New, integer.
Namnge den till nglayout.initialpaint.delay och sätt value till 0.

Det här anger hur länge FF ska vänta med att "rita" upp sidan.

Nu ska sidladdningarna gå avsevärt fortare, men det krävs en omstart av FF för att inställningarna ska börja gälla.
Ni kan exprimentera med med inställningarna ovan, men sätt inte värden för högt, vissa webbservar tror det är en Flood-attack eller nåt i den stilen ifall den får för många requests från samma IP.

Det var väl allt jag hade att dela med mig av förtillfället, men fråga gärna ifall det är nåt speciellt ni vill ändra, i form av utseende eller funktioner. Problem är till för att lösas.

Just det, ni kan ladda ner G4 optimerade builds av Firefox HÄR . Det snabbar upp tiden det tar för FF att starta, tar ca 4s med optimerade builds mot för 8s med standardbuilds, så där har ni tid att spara.

Ifall ni har några frågor/önskemål så är det bara att ni ställer dem här, eller så PMar ni dem till mig, så ska jag fortsätta att uppdatera den här guiden när jag fixat era önskemål.

Kan säg att det går att göra det mesta, det är just därför jag gillar FF, allt är går att ändra precis som man vill ha det.

Tillägg:

I About:config

Sätt browser.link.open_external till value 3, det här gör att alla länkar som FF mottar från andra applikationer öppnas i en nya TAB istället för i ett nytt fönster.

Sätt browser.link.open_newwindow till value 3, för att öppna alla andra länkar som vanligen skulle öppnas i ett nytt fönster öppnas i en ny TAB.

Nu borde TAB surfingen funkar bättre, kom gärna med feedback ifall det inte funkar.

Senast redigerat 2005-02-27 12:29
  • Medlem
  • Stockholm
  • 2005-02-27 00:14

Tjacke är en guru. Jag ska genast testa.

Bra tips!

Det finns G5-optimerade builds också. 1.0.1 ser inte ut att ha blivit kompilerad än, men den kommer nog snart.

  • Medlem
  • Göteborg
  • 2005-02-27 11:55

Kanon, funkade ju utmärkt!

  • Medlem
  • Uddevalla
  • 2005-02-27 11:55
Ursprungligen av Tjacke:

Vi börjar med att göra så att alla länkar öppnas i nya tabbar:

Skriv About:config i adressfältet i FF

Skriv sen i Filter, singlewindow.openexternal , ändra sen value till true
gör likadant med singlewindow.openintabs , sätt den till true

Nu ska alla dina länkar öppnas i nya tabbar istället för nya fönster.

Tack för tipsen! Mycket värdefullt! Men, förlåt en dumskalle, jag lyckas inte med den första inställningen. När jag skriver in singlewindow.openexternal töms sidan, bortsett från rubrikerna: Preference name, Status, Type och Value. Jag sitter alltså med Filter: singlewindow.openexternal, samt rubrikerna och undrar vad jag gör sen. Var ändrar jag till exempel value? Tacksam för hjälp, för jag vill gärna ha den här inställningen.

Ursprungligen av marta:

Tack för tipsen! Mycket värdefullt! Men, förlåt en dumskalle, jag lyckas inte med den första inställningen. När jag skriver in singlewindow.openexternal töms sidan, bortsett från rubrikerna: Preference name, Status, Type och Value. Jag sitter alltså med Filter: singlewindow.openexternal, samt rubrikerna och undrar vad jag gör sen. Var ändrar jag till exempel value? Tacksam för hjälp, för jag vill gärna ha den här inställningen.

Borde gå att fixa på följande sätt: Högerklicka i den tomma ytan bland alla värden och välj ny sträng. Skriv in vad den ska heta, klicka OK och ange sedan värdet när detta efterfrågas. Eller ska det kanske vara heltal? Vad är skillnaden?

Senast redigerat 2006-12-17 16:57

Hmm, märkligt.
Prova med att starta om FF, gå in i About:config och prova igen, men den här gången så bläddrar du ner till singlewindow.openexternal utan att använda filterfunktionen, har du inte den inställningen så är det troligen nåt fel på din firefox.app, För den ska finnas. Om det inte hjälper så kanske du behöver byta ut den, dvs ladda ner en nya firefox.app.

Du ändrar Value genom att dubbelklicka med musknappen på just den inställningen, dvs på true eller false, då ändras den antingen till false eller true och Status till user set vilket betyder att du har ändrat inställningarna själv.

Till er andra:

Berätta gärna ifall ni upplever det snabbare, både i uppstarten och sidladdningarna. Berätta också gärna vilken uppkoppling ni har så jag kan göra en lite bättre lista som är specificerad för just en viss uppkoppling. Och ifall ni har använt några andra inställningar och exstensions.
Kan även säga att ifall man använder exstensions så slöar det ner firefox, därför är det bättre att skriva in direkt i about:config

Det finns också möjlighet att fixa så att alla bokmärken öppnas i nya tabbar, och att tabbarn öppnas i bakrunden. Dvs när du klickar på en länk så stannar du kvar i den första tabben och den nya tabben laddas i bakrunden. Kan skriva in det i guiden också, ifall intresset finns. Men kom gärna med mer önskemål så ska jag försöka hitta en lösning på problemet.

Försöker f ö att skapa en inställningsfil med mina inställningar för er som inte vill mixtra i About:config . Men lyckas inte särskilt bra förtillfället. Så ifall någon annan har den kunskapen så dela gärna med er den till mig.

  • Medlem
  • Uddevalla
  • 2005-02-27 13:04
Ursprungligen av Tjacke:

Hmm, märkligt.
Prova med att starta om FF, gå in i About:config och prova igen, men den här gången så bläddrar du ner till singlewindow.openexternal utan att använda filterfunktionen, har du inte den inställningen så är det troligen nåt fel på din firefox.app, För den ska finnas. Om det inte hjälper så kanske du behöver byta ut den, dvs ladda ner en nya firefox.app.

Du gissar rätt. Singlewindow… finns inte, så jag får väl ladda ner en ny firefox.app. Tack för hjälpen.

  • Oregistrerad
  • 2005-02-27 18:30
Ursprungligen av Tjacke:

Hmm, märkligt.
Prova med att starta om FF, gå in i About:config och prova igen, men den här gången så bläddrar du ner till singlewindow.openexternal utan att använda filterfunktionen, har du inte den inställningen så är det troligen nåt fel på din firefox.app, För den ska finnas. Om det inte hjälper så kanske du behöver byta ut den, dvs ladda ner en nya firefox.app.

Du ändrar Value genom att dubbelklicka med musknappen på just den inställningen, dvs på true eller false, då ändras den antingen till false eller true och Status till user set vilket betyder att du har ändrat inställningarna själv.

Jag har inte singelwindow.openexternal även efter en om/ny installation av senaste Firefox. Tips? Idéer?

  • Medlem
  • Uppsala
  • 2005-02-27 20:15
Ursprungligen av stenugn:

Jag har inte singelwindow.openexternal även efter en om/ny installation av senaste Firefox.

Samma här. Har den varken på min iBook eller i någon av mina bägge PC:ar. Alla kör FF 1.0.

  • Medlem
  • Göteborg
  • 2005-02-27 13:16

Sitter med en iBook G3 800 MHz och 10mbit SUNET-uppkoppling. Kändes som att firefox blev en hel del snabbare efter tipset ditt!

Open in tabs grejen funkar oxå bra. Har dock en fråga: Går det att fixa så att länkar som öppnas i ett pop-up fönster mha javascript inte öppnas i en ny tab, men att alla andra länkar öppnas i ny tab?

Hmm, skulle vara ifall du ändrar Value i browser.link.open_newwindow.restriction till 1 det gör att alla javascripts popups öppnas som de gör i Internet Explorer dvs i ett nytt fönster. Som default så är värdet 0, och value 1 ger samma betende som IE.

Sätter du däremot value till 2 så fångar FF fönstret ifall den inte har en specifik storlek och ifall den ska ha en statusbar. Vilket gör att den blir mindre än själva FF fönstret med tabbarna.
Det här är faktiskt ganska användbart för på så sätt kan man se både själva FF och det nya popupfönstret. Men kom ihåg att de flesta reklampopups har en specifik storlek osv.
Så var på din vakt.

Kanske lite luddigt förklarat, men jag tror du förstår.
Jag kör f ö med Value 0 på den inställningen, bara för att jag hatar popups.

Har själv inte testat just det här, så du kan gärna ge feedback på hur du tyckte det blev, om det är att rekomendera vill säga. Och ifall det var det du var ute efter.

  • Medlem
  • Göteborg
  • 2005-02-27 13:41
Ursprungligen av Tjacke:

Hmm, skulle vara ifall du ändrar Value i browser.link.open_newwindow.restriction till 1 det gör att alla javascripts popups öppnas som de gör i Internet Explorer dvs i ett nytt fönster. Som default så är värdet 0, och value 1 ger samma betende som IE.

Sätter du däremot value till 2 så fångar FF fönstret ifall den inte har en specifik storlek och ifall den ska ha en statusbar. Vilket gör att den blir mindre än själva FF fönstret med tabbarna.
Det här är faktiskt ganska användbart för på så sätt kan man se både själva FF och det nya popupfönstret. Men kom ihåg att de flesta reklampopups har en specifik storlek osv.
Så var på din vakt.

Kanske lite luddigt förklarat, men jag tror du förstår.
Jag kör f ö med Value 0 på den inställningen, bara för att jag hatar popups.

Har själv inte testat just det här, så du kan gärna ge feedback på hur du tyckte det blev, om det är att rekomendera vill säga. Och ifall det var det du var ute efter.

Perfekt! Value 1 fixade biffen. Popups är störande om dom är oönskade, men där stoppar ju Firefox ändå som standard... Önskade popups har jag ingenting emot

Kanske någon snäll moderator kan göra den här klibbig eller flytta den till ett lite bättre forum, kanske switcherforumet borde vara nåt?

Skumt, kör ju själv G4 optimerade builds, den senaste, 26/2.
Har kollat på min PC också, alla inställningar funkar f ö där också. det är standard 1.0.0 av FF.
Kör du 1.0.1 eller? dvs den med den nya säkerhetspatchen?

Ska höra med några Dev killar, kanske de har nån anning om varför flera har det problemet. Kanske bara är en bugg.

  • Oregistrerad
  • 2005-02-27 19:24
Ursprungligen av Tjacke:

Skumt, kör ju själv G4 optimerade builds, den senaste, 26/2.
Har kollat på min PC också, alla inställningar funkar f ö där också. det är standard 1.0.0 av FF.
Kör du 1.0.1 eller? dvs den med den nya säkerhetspatchen?

Ja, jag kör med senaste, 1.0.1

Hmm, ni som inte harSinglewindow.openexternal kan prov att använda inställningarna jag la till högst upp i tweakningsguiden dvs Tilläggen. Tydligen så finns inte vissa inställningar i vissa builds, pga av att det finns 2 st grenar av Firefoxbuilden. Aviary och Trunk. Om jag har förstått saken rätt på knaglig engelska på mozillazine forumet.

De påpekade också att vissa inställningra inte har någon funktion, pga att de ligger kvar sen Beta stadiet, och de har ersatts av andra inställningar. Ifall ni har problem så ska det finnas andra inställningar.

Ni kan läsa mer HÄR om about:config.
i det här fallet kan jag inte hjälpa er, pga av att jag inte vet vad som gör att ni inte har den här inställningen. Det lilla jag kan göra är att be er testa de optimerad G4 versionen, för där får jag då mina inställningar att funka. Skulle vara kul att veta ifall det är många fler som har samma problem med just det hära. Det går att lösa på andra sätt också, men då måste jag guida er i blindo tyvärr.

Ska fortsätta söka efter en lösning, tillsvidare är det enda rådet jag kan ge er att testa de optimerad versionerna.

Senast redigerat 2005-03-08 11:51

Tack Tjacke för uppritningstweeken, mkt snabbare.

Citat:

...fråga gärna ifall det är nåt speciellt ni vill ändra, i form av utseende eller funktioner. Problem är till för att lösas.

Jag efterlyser några andra funktioner till FF, som du eller någon annan kanske kan lösa...

1. Kan man få FF att rita upp knappar, rullgardiner, formulär och kryssrutor (mm) med OSX aqua?

2. Önskar mig en "senaste sökningar gardin" till sökfönstret. Som gardinpilen längst till höger i adressfältet.

3. Saknar autofyll-funktionen i Safari.
Så man slipper knappa in adress och email osv på nytt varje gång. Mkt smidigt.

4. Ett invant beteende är att jag trycker på backspace-tangenten, <-- (heter den så?) när jag vill stega bak en sida. Eller Shift+Backspace för att stega fram en sida. Tyvärr funkar inte detta med FF.

---------
upptäckte nyligen att man kan öppna ett sökfält längst ner i fönstret (äpple+F) Mkt användbart.

  • Oregistrerad
  • 2005-03-10 10:19

Tackar!

Klar hastighetsförbättring. Nu hinner jag surfa ännu mer på jobbet!

  • Medlem
  • Danderyd
  • 2005-03-15 15:01

Det fungerar ju fin fint - förutom det första med singlewindow då...

Jag har dock ett "problem" med scrollningsfunktionen på min nya PB. När jag scrollar med två fingar händer det att firefox läser mouse-gestures som back/bakåt och forward/framåt om jag råkar röra fingrarna i sidled och klicka med ena fingret. Det har gjort att jag inte använder scrollningsfunktionen eftersom det allt som oftast blir fel och FF börjar hoppa frammåt och bakåt i history.

Är det någon som kan hjälpa mig att stänga av denna, i och för sig trevliga funktion, men som retar gallfeber på mig...

/G

  • Oregistrerad
  • 2005-03-17 23:41

Finns det svenska G4-optimerade builds också?

EDIT: Har startat om FF nu - jävlar, vilken skillnad i fart! Tusen tack!

tackar... men givetvis var jag anit-datahacker och gjorde ett fel...

när jag skulle skapa nglayout.initialpaint.delay råkade jag av rena farten välja sträng istället för heltal och nu kan jag inte på något sätt ändra det värdet? man kan ju i principip ändra allt annat men inte just det... och skapar jag en ny så tar den gamla över bara...

hur sjutton gör man det??

ah... nu löste det sig!

man var tvungen att markera "raden", välja återställ och sen STÄNGA NER hela skiten... så var det bara att starta upp allt och göra om det. jösses... varför inte bara ha en delete-knapp...

jaja. tack ändå

Supernice!

säg finns det någon inställning för antal samtidiga nedladdningar i downloadsmanagern, både safari och firefox verkar helt sakna möjlighet att bestämma det, Internet explorer lät ju användaren definiera sånt, har det blivit omodernt eller vaddå? Blir u så segt när allt ska ladda samtidigt...

  • Medlem
  • Mölndal
  • 2005-06-12 22:52

Hittade denna diskussion på ämnet via Google:

http://sillydog.org/forum/viewtopic.php?t=8801

Nämen titta att ni hittade hit. Som sagt network.http.max-connections borde fixa biffen åt er.

Något mer ni undrar över?

Hit me then.

Tack för tipsen - fungerar utmärkt och känns kvickare.

  • Medlem
  • 2005-06-15 17:04

Hej Tjacke!

Tack för tips. Har just börjat använda FireFox och har följt din guide (har bla en version som nu gör att den blå bollen är ett litet äpple...).

Har nog ändå misslyckats lite: jag vill att det ska öppnas en ny tab när jag klickar på en länk och håller ner cmd-knappen. Går det att få till?

Trodde att det var det man fixade, men kanske har jag missuppfattat något?

-Cilla

  • Medlem
  • 2005-06-15 17:27

Tjacke

Ursäkta mig. Det fungerar visst. Är bara så att den nya tabben inte markeras, men det tror jag att jag kan fixa själv.

-Cilla

  • Medlem
  • Harestad
  • 2005-06-16 12:33
Ursprungligen av cilla:

Tjacke

Ursäkta mig. Det fungerar visst. Är bara så att den nya tabben inte markeras, men det tror jag att jag kan fixa själv.

-Cilla

Klickar man på en länk med Cmd intryckt så öppnas den i en ny tab. Men ...

... klickar man på en länk och håller inne Cmd+Shift så öppnas den i en ny tab överst.

Bevaka tråden